PTY5101 | Musculo-Skeletal Physiotherapy 1 | ||
SCHOOL OF EXERCISE AND HEALTH SCIENCES | |||
Credit Points: 15 | |||
Description: | |||
In this unit, students will learn the art of therapeutic touch through massage. Students will study normal gait and identify the pathologies behind abnormal gait. Students will become familiar with the application of common assessment tools used in musculo-skeletal physiotherapy and the manual therapy treatments of the lower limb. Students will learn how to plan and progress treatments of the lower limb using a client-centred focus. The physiotherapy management of the patient with lower limb orthopedic conditions is also covered. Full Unit Outline | |||
